Cutaneous wounds, such as those resulting from vesicant exposure and thermal injuries, provide an ideal environment for bacterial growth and the complications stemming from wound sepsis. The availability of ready-to-use, antimicrobial skin substitutes that are readily deployed in the field would provide immediate wound closure and reduce the incidence of infection in these wounds. To address these needs, Stratatech Corporation is developing a field-ready, tissue engineered antimicrobial therapeutic called EpiReadyDefense™ for treatment of vesicant, thermal and traumatic cutaneous injuries. This product is designed to contain elevated levels of naturally-occurring antimicrobial peptides in the context of a fully-stratified skin substitute that is ready to use and stable at ambient temperatures. During Phase I of the project, procedures will be developed to format Stratatech’s existing antimicrobial skin substitute for ambient storage. Efforts will focus on preserving tissue architecture and strength, as well as maintaining the antimicrobial properties required in the final product. In Phase II, the antimicrobial properties of EpiReadyDefense™ will be determined in an established animal model of burn wound infection. Phase II studies will also include preclinical safety studies that will be required to support ultimate clinical evaluation and approval of EpiReadyDefense™ tissue.
